In 1903, the rail line was opened to traffic by Lord Curzon, the then Viceroy of India. The quaint rail track passes through some of the most picturesque spots as it winds it way from Kalka, which lies at the foot of the Shivaliks, to the mighty ridge on which the Queen of the Hills is located.
